+ <para>
+ Often happens that the upstream code doesn't fit well into the
+ Debian distribution: be this wrong paths, missing features, anything
+ that implies editing the source files. When you directly edit
+ upstream's source files, your changes will be put into a .diff.gz file
+ if you use the <literal>1.0</literal> source format and in a monolithic
+ patch if you use the <literal>3.0 (quilt)</literal> format. To better
+ organise the patches and group the by function, please use a patch
+ handling system which keeps patches under the <filename
+ class="directory">debian/patches</filename> directory.
+ </para>
+ <para>
+ The <literal>3.0 (quilt)</literal> Dpkg source format provides its own
+ patch system. Apart from this, the most popular is
+ <command>quilt</command>. <emphasis>simple-patchsys</emphasis>, from
+ the <package>CDBS</package> package, is deprecated since version
+ <literal>0.4.85</literal>. <command>dpatch</command> has been popular
+ as well, but is not compatible with the <literal>3.0 (quilt)</literal>
+ source format. Please don't use any other patch system in Debian Med,
+ unless absolutely necessary.
+ </para>
